Common Data Models Harmonization
1.0.0 - STU 1 Publication

Common Data Models Harmonization, published by HL7 International - Biomedical Research and Regulation Work Group. This is not an authorized publication; it is the continuous build for version 1.0.0). This version is based on the current content of https://github.com/HL7/cdmh/ and changes regularly. See the Directory of published versions

: Cdmh EHR Capability Statement - XML Representation

Raw xml | Download



<CapabilityStatement xmlns="http://hl7.org/fhir">
  <id value="cdmh-ehr"/>
  <text>
    <status value="generated"/>
    <div xmlns="http://www.w3.org/1999/xhtml">
      <h2>EHR</h2>
      <p>(Requirements Definition Capability Statement)</p>
      <p>Canonical URL: http://hl7.org/fhir/us/cdmh/CapabilityStatement/cdmh-ehr</p>
      <p>Published by: <b>HL7 International - Public Health Work Group</b>
      </p>
      <p>This profile defines the expected capabilities of the <i>EHR </i> actor to support the CDMH IG use cases.  
      This actor is responsible for supporting ResearchStudy, Group Resource, Group export operations along with the CDMH IG and US Core profiles.</p>
      <h2>General</h2>
      <div class="table-wrapper">
        <table>
          <tbody>
            <tr>
              <th>FHIR Version:</th>
              <td>4.0.1</td>
            </tr>
            <tr>
              <th>Supported formats:</th>
              <td>json</td>
            </tr>
          </tbody>
        </table>
      </div>
      <h2>REST  behavior</h2>
      <p>The primary focus of the EHR is to allow the creation of a ResearchStudy, Group resource and support the Group export operation for the CDMH IG and US Core profiles. </p>
      <p>
        <b>Security:</b>
      </p>
      <p>Implementations must meet the general security requirements documented in FHIR <a href="http://hl7.org/fhir/security.html">Security guidance</a>.</p>

      <h3>US Core Support</h3>

      <p>
      The EHR <b>SHALL</b> support the profiles listed in 
      <a href="http://hl7.org/fhir/us/core/STU4/CapabilityStatement-us-core-server.html">US Core Server capability statement</a> as foundational FHIR profiles needed by the CDMH IG.
      </p>
      <br/>

      <h3>CDMH IG Profiles</h3>

      <p>
      The EHR <b>SHOULD</b> support the profiles listed in 
      <a href="artifacts.html">CDMH IG</a> for populating multiple common data models.
      </p>
      <br/>

      <h3>Resource summary</h3>
      <div class="table-wrapper">
        <table class="grid">
          <thead>
            <tr>
              <th>Resource</th>
              <th>Search</th>
              <th>Read</th>
              <th>Read Version</th>
              <th>Instance History</th>
              <th>Resource History</th>
              <th>Create</th>
              <th>Update</th>
              <th>Delete</th>
              <th>Operations</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th><a href="http://hl7.org/fhir/R4/researchstudy.html">ResearchStudy</a></th>
              <td>
                <a href="#ResearchStudy-search" title="Allows search of a specific ResearchStudy Resource instances using names and identifiers.">SHALL</a>
              </td>
              <td>
                <a href="#ResearchStudy-read" title="Allows retrieval of specific ResearchStudy instances using ids.">SHALL</a>
              </td>
              <td>
              </td>
              <td>               
              </td>
              <td>
              </td>
              <td>
                <a href="#ResearchStudy-create" title="Allows creation of a specific ResearchStudy Resource instance to record participants in a research program.">SHALL</a>
              </td>
              <td>
              </td>
              <td>
              </td>
              <td>
              </td>
            </tr>
            <tr>
              <th><a href="http://hl7.org/fhir/R4/group.html">Group</a></th>
              <td>
                <a href="#Group-search" title="Allows search of a specific Group Resource instances using names and identifiers.">SHALL</a>
              </td>
              <td>
                <a href="#Group-read" title="Allows retrieval of specific Group instances using ids.">SHALL</a>
              </td>
              <td>
              </td>
              <td>               
              </td>
              <td>
              </td>
              <td>
                <a href="#Group-create" title="Allows creation of a specific Group Resource instance to record participants in a research program.">SHALL</a>
              </td>
              <td>
              </td>
              <td>
              </td>
              <td>
                <a href="#Group-export" title="Allows bulk export of data using the Group/$export operation">Bulk Data IG: Group/$export: SHALL</a>
              </td>
            </tr>
            <tr>
              <th>US Core Profiles</th>
              <td>
              </td>
              <td>
                <a href="#USCore-read" title="Allows retrieval of a specific US Core Resource instances as part of the Group/$export operation.">SHALL</a>
              </td>
              <td>
              </td>
              <td>               
              </td>
              <td>
              </td>
              <td>
              </td>
              <td>
              </td>
			        <td>
              </td>
              <td>
              </td>
            </tr>
            <tr>
              <th><a href="artifacts.html#structures-resource-profiles">CDMH IG Profiles</a></th>
              <td>
              </td>
              <td>
                <a href="#CDMH-read" title="Allows retrieval of a specific CDMH Resource instances as part of the Group/$export operation.">SHALL</a>
              </td>
              <td>
              </td>
              <td>               
              </td>
              <td>
              </td>
              <td>
              </td>
              <td>
              </td>
              <td>
              </td>
              <td>
              </td>
            </tr>
          </tbody>
        </table>
      </div>
     
      <br/>
      <br/>

      <h3>
        <a href="http://hl7.org/fhir/researchstudy.html">ResearchStudy</a>
      </h3>
      <p>Profile: <a href="StructureDefinition-cdmh-researchstudy.html">CdmhResearchStudy</a>
      </p>
      <h4>Interactions</h4>
      <div class="table-wrapper">
        <table class="list">
          <thead>
            <tr>
              <th>Name</th>
              <th>Description</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th>
                <a name="ResearchStudy-create"> </a>
                <span>search</span>
              </th>
              <td>
                <p>Allows creation of a specific ResearchStudy resource instances to record participants in a research program.</p>
              </td>
            </tr>
            <tr>
              <th>
                <a name="ResearchStudy-search"> </a>
                <span>search</span>
              </th>
              <td>
                <p>Allows searching of specific ResearchStudy resource profile instances.</p>
              </td>
            </tr>
            <tr>
              <th>
                <a name="ResearchStudy-read"> </a>
                <span>read</span>
              </th>
              <td>
                <p>Allows retrieval of specific ResearchStudy resource profile instances</p>
              </td>
            </tr> 
          </tbody>
        </table>
      </div>
      <br/>
      <br/>   

      <h4>Search</h4>
      <div class="table-wrapper">
        <table class="list">
          <thead>
            <tr>
              <th>Parameter</th>
              <th>Type</th>
              <th>Definition &amp; Chaining</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th>identifier</th>
              <td>token</td>
              <td>Search using identifiers.</td>
            </tr>
            <tr>
              <th>title</th>
              <td>string</td>
              <td>Search using ResearchStudy name which represents the Research program name.</td>
            </tr>
          </tbody>
        </table>
      </div>
      
      <h3>
        <a href="http://hl7.org/fhir/group.html">Group</a>
      </h3>
      <p>Profile: <a href="StructureDefinition-cdmh-group.html">CdmhGroup</a>
      </p>
      <h4>Interactions</h4>
      <div class="table-wrapper">
        <table class="list">
          <thead>
            <tr>
              <th>Name</th>
              <th>Description</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th>
                <a name="Group-create"> </a>
                <span>search</span>
              </th>
              <td>
                <p>Allows creation of a specific Group resource instances to record participants in a research program.</p>
              </td>
            </tr>
            <tr>
              <th>
                <a name="Group-search"> </a>
                <span>search</span>
              </th>
              <td>
                <p>Allows searching of specific Group resource profile instances.</p>
              </td>
            </tr>
            <tr>
              <th>
                <a name="Group-read"> </a>
                <span>read</span>
              </th>
              <td>
                <p>Allows retrieval of specific Group resource profile instances</p>
              </td>
            </tr> 
            <tr>
              <th>
                <a name="Group-export"> </a>
                <span>Bulk Data IG: Group/$export operation</span>
              </th>
              <td>
                <p>Allows retrieval of specific data associated with patients who are part of the Group.</p>
              </td>
            </tr> 
          </tbody>
        </table>
      </div>
      <br/>
      <br/>   

      <h4>Search</h4>
      <div class="table-wrapper">
        <table class="list">
          <thead>
            <tr>
              <th>Parameter</th>
              <th>Type</th>
              <th>Definition &amp; Chaining</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th>identifier</th>
              <td>token</td>
              <td>Search using identifiers.</td>
            </tr>
            <tr>
              <th>name</th>
              <td>string</td>
              <td>Search using Group name which represents the Research program name.</td>
            </tr>
          </tbody>
        </table>
      </div>

      <h3>
        <a href="http://hl7.org/fhir/us/core">US Core Profiles</a>
      </h3>
      <p>Profile: <a href="http://hl7.org/fhir/us/core/STU4/CapabilityStatement-us-core-server.html">Profiles listed in US Core</a>
      </p>
      <h4>Interactions</h4>
      <div class="table-wrapper">
        <table class="list">
          <thead>
            <tr>
              <th>Name</th>
              <th>Description</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th>
                <a name="USCore-read"> </a>
                <span>read</span>
              </th>
              <td>
                <p>Allows retrieval of specific US Core resource profile instances as part of the Group/$export operation.</p>
              </td>
            </tr> 
          </tbody>
        </table>
      </div>
      <br/>
      <br/> 

      <h3>
        <a>CDMH IG Profiles</a>
      </h3>
      <p>Profile: <a href="artifacts.html#structures-resource-profiles">Profiles listed in CDMH IG</a>
      </p>
      <h4>Interactions</h4>
      <div class="table-wrapper">
        <table class="list">
          <thead>
            <tr>
              <th>Name</th>
              <th>Description</th>
            </tr>
          </thead>
          <tbody>
            <tr>
              <th>
                <a name="CDMH-read"> </a>
                <span>read</span>
              </th>
              <td>
                <p>Allows retrieval of specific CDMH resource profile instances as part of the Group/$export operation.</p>
              </td>
            </tr> 
          </tbody>
        </table>
      </div>
      <br/>
      <br/>
      
    </div>
  </text>
  <url value="http://hl7.org/fhir/us/cdmh/CapabilityStatement/cdmh-ehr"/>
  <version value="1.0.0"/>
  <name value="CdmhEHRCapabilityStatement"/>
  <title value="Cdmh EHR Capability Statement"/>
  <status value="draft"/>
  <date value="2020-12-06"/>
  <publisher
             value="HL7 International - Biomedical Research and Regulation Work Group"/>
  <contact>
    <telecom>
      <system value="url"/>
      <value value="http://hl7.org/Special/committees/rcrim"/>
    </telecom>
  </contact>
  <description
               value="This profile defines the expected capabilities of the &#39;&#39;EHR&#39;&#39; actor when conforming to the CDMH IG.     This role is responsible for allowing creation and retrieval of ResearchStudy, and Group resources, along with retrieval of clinical data using the Group/$export operation."/>
  <jurisdiction>
    <coding>
      <system value="urn:iso:std:iso:3166"/>
      <code value="US"/>
    </coding>
  </jurisdiction>
  <copyright
             value="Used by permission of HL7, all rights reserved Creative Commons License"/>
  <kind value="requirements"/>
  <fhirVersion value="4.0.1"/>
  <format value="json"/>
  <rest>
    <mode value="server"/>
    <documentation
                   value="The focus of the EHR is to allow creation and retrieval of ResearchStudy and Group resources and clinical data using the Group/$export operation."/>
    <security>
      <description
                   value="Implementations must meet the general security requirements documented in the security section of the implementation guide."/>
    </security>
    <resource>
      <type value="ResearchStudy"/>
      <interaction>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<code value="read"/>
        <documentation
                       value="Allows retrieval of a specific ResearchStudy instance."/>
      </interaction>
      <interaction>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<code value="create"/>
        <documentation
                       value="Allows creation of a ResearchStudy resource instance."/>
      </interaction>
      <interaction>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<code value="search-type"/>
        <documentation
                       value="Allows search of a ResearchStudy resource instance using identifiers and names."/>
      </interaction>
      <searchParam>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<name value="identifier"/>
        <definition value="http://hl7.org/fhir/SearchParameter/Group-identifier"/>
        <type value="token"/>
      </searchParam>
    </resource>
    <resource>
      <type value="Group"/>
      <interaction>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<code value="read"/>
        <documentation value="Allows retrieval of a specific Group instance."/>
      </interaction>
      <interaction>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<code value="create"/>
        <documentation value="Allows creation of a Group resource instance."/>
      </interaction>
      <interaction>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<code value="search-type"/>
        <documentation
                       value="Allows search of a Group resource instance using identifiers and names."/>
      </interaction>
      <searchParam>
        <extension
                   url="http://hl7.org/fhir/StructureDefinition/capabilitystatement-expectation">
          <valueCode value="SHALL"/>
        </extension>
        <name value="identifier"/>
        <definition value="http://hl7.org/fhir/SearchParameter/Group-identifier"/>
        <type value="token"/>
      </searchParam>
      <operation>
        <name value="export"/>
        <definition
                    value="http://hl7.org/fhir/uv/bulkdata/OperationDefinition/group-export"/>
      </operation>
    </resource>
  </rest>
</CapabilityStatement>